    Magnets in electric-powered cleaning equipment

    Published: 2023-06-18 11:34:11 • Ramin Ebrahimnia

    Find out how magnets are a key part of the development of high-performance electric cleaning equipment.

    Electric-powered cleaning tools are becoming more popular in the cleaning business. This is because people want to find solutions that are both efficient and good for the environment. Magnets are an important part of making high-performance electric cleaning tools that work better and use less energy.

    1. Electric motors are what make cleaning equipment that runs on electricity work. Magnets are important parts of these motors because they provide the force needed to make them move.

    Brushless DC Motors: Many electric cleaning tools, like vacuum cleaners and floor scrubbers, use brushless DC motors. These motors use permanent magnets to create a rotating magnetic field. Compared to brushed motors, these motors have many benefits, such as being more efficient, making less noise, and lasting longer.

    Better performance: When high-performance magnets, like neodymium magnets, are used in electric motors, the power output and energy efficiency can be increased. This means that electric cleaning equipment can do a better job of cleaning while using less energy.

    2. Magnets are also used in the sense- and control systems of electric cleaning machines to make sure they work well and are easy to use.

    Position sensing: Magnetic sensors can be used to find out where different parts of electric cleaning equipment are and how they are moving. This allows for precise control and adjustments that make cleaning more effective.

    User Interface: Magnets, like magnetic switches and connectors, can be built into the user interface of electric cleaning tools to make them more durable and easy to use.

    3. How magnets will be used in electric cleaning tools in the future.

    More advanced motor designs: Ongoing research and development could lead to even more efficient and powerful electric motor designs, which would make electric cleaning equipment even better.

    New and different uses: Magnets can be used in new and different ways to clean, such as in robotic cleaning systems. This helps to create more advanced and self-sufficient ways to clean.

    We can conclude that magnets are a key part of making high-performance electric cleaning equipment that is more efficient, lasts longer, and does a better job of cleaning overall.
